Class BreakpointHandlerViewerContentProvider
java.lang.Object
com._1c.g5.v8.dt.eventhandlers.ui.providers.AbstractEventHandlersContentProvider
com._1c.g5.v8.dt.eventhandlers.ui.providers.AbstractExtensionHandlersProvidingContentProvider
com._1c.g5.v8.dt.eventhandlers.ui.providers.FilterHandlerViewerContentProvider
com._1c.g5.v8.dt.eventhandlers.ui.providers.BreakpointHandlerViewerContentProvider
- All Implemented Interfaces:
IContentProvider,IStructuredContentProvider,ITreeContentProvider
Content provider for
SetBreakpointDialog handler viewer.-
Field Summary
Fields inherited from class com._1c.g5.v8.dt.eventhandlers.ui.providers.AbstractExtensionHandlersProvidingContentProvider
configuration, globalScopeProvider -
Constructor Summary
ConstructorsConstructorDescriptionBreakpointHandlerViewerContentProvider(Configuration configuration, IV8ProjectManager projectManager, org.eclipse.xtext.scoping.IGlobalScopeProvider globalScopeProvider, IBslOwnerComputerService bslOwnerComputerService, org.eclipse.xtext.naming.IQualifiedNameProvider qualifiedNameProvider) Constructor. -
Method Summary
Modifier and TypeMethodDescriptionprotected org.eclipse.xtext.naming.QualifiedNamecreateModuleName(HandlerContainer element) Creates qualified module name.Object[]getChildren(Object parentElement) Object[]getElements(Object inputElement) booleanhasChildren(Object element) Methods inherited from class com._1c.g5.v8.dt.eventhandlers.ui.providers.FilterHandlerViewerContentProvider
createCacheMethods inherited from class com._1c.g5.v8.dt.eventhandlers.ui.providers.AbstractExtensionHandlersProvidingContentProvider
getExtensions, getLastSegment, getParent, hasExtensionsMethods inherited from class com._1c.g5.v8.dt.eventhandlers.ui.providers.AbstractEventHandlersContentProvider
dispose, inputChanged
-
Constructor Details
-
BreakpointHandlerViewerContentProvider
public BreakpointHandlerViewerContentProvider(Configuration configuration, IV8ProjectManager projectManager, org.eclipse.xtext.scoping.IGlobalScopeProvider globalScopeProvider, IBslOwnerComputerService bslOwnerComputerService, org.eclipse.xtext.naming.IQualifiedNameProvider qualifiedNameProvider) Constructor.- Parameters:
configuration- - configuration. Can't benull.projectManager- - v8 project manager. Can't benull.globalScopeProvider- - global scope provider. Can't benull.bslOwnerComputerService- - bsl owner computer service. Can't benull.qualifiedNameProvider- - qualified name provider. Can't benull.
-
-
Method Details
-
getElements
- Specified by:
getElementsin interfaceIStructuredContentProvider- Specified by:
getElementsin interfaceITreeContentProvider- Overrides:
getElementsin classFilterHandlerViewerContentProvider
-
hasChildren
- Specified by:
hasChildrenin interfaceITreeContentProvider- Overrides:
hasChildrenin classFilterHandlerViewerContentProvider
-
getChildren
- Specified by:
getChildrenin interfaceITreeContentProvider- Overrides:
getChildrenin classFilterHandlerViewerContentProvider
-
createModuleName
Description copied from class:AbstractExtensionHandlersProvidingContentProviderCreates qualified module name.- Overrides:
createModuleNamein classAbstractExtensionHandlersProvidingContentProvider- Parameters:
element- - element to create module name. Can't benull.- Returns:
- qualified module name. Can't return
null.
-